Rhine Falls Rhine Falls
  About Rhine Falls   Rhine Falls are spectacular falls in Switzerland, one of the most popular touristic destinations in the country. The Rhine falls consist of a series of three falls, The Zurcher, the Schaffhauser and Muhle falls. Dublin Castle Dublin Castle
A precious castle that amazes for its imposant structure is the Dublin Castle, which was built firstly in 1204. It was constructed on the orders of King John of England, on a place where the Vikings used to live once. The structure supposed to be formed by strong walls, deep and well done ditches, in this way defending the city, and the King’s treasure. The Abbey Theatre The Abbey Theatre
The Abbey Theatre is considered the National Theatre of Ireland, and it was  officially opened to the public in July 1966. Its opening was the begining of a new era for the National Theatre of Ireland, that marks a period of fruitful success.The theatre was established in 1904, by W.B Yeats and Lady Gregory, contributing to the world’s most famous works of theatre, from writers like J.M Synge and Sean O’Casey. Vidimyri Turf Church Vidimyri Turf Church
   The Vidimyri Turf Church  is one of the most beautiful churches, which is a great testimony of the long era of architecture, typical for Iceland, at the period when all the buildings were made of stones and turf. The Church of Vidimyri is located in Skagafjordur, and was built in 1836, being used  nowadays for religious services. Vigeland Park Vigeland Park
   Vigeland Park is a great treasure for the city of Oslo, who was dedicated to Gustav Vigeland, who made those spactacular sculptures that beautify the park. The park covers an area of about 80 acres, and includes 212 sculptures, all modelled by the famous sculptor Gustav Vigeland. He designed the architectural style of the park and also the layout of the ground. Lake Burley Griffin Lake Burley Griffin
  Lake Burley Griffin is one of the main attractions in Canberra. The lake is not a natural one, is an artificial lake in the centre of Canberra, and is considered to be one of the most spectacular beauty spots in the City. The lake was created in 1963 after the Molonglo River was dammed and is the city’s centerpiece. Because of its location, the lake has various important institutions lying on its shores.
